April 4, 2003 -- (WEB HOST INDUSTRY REVIEW) -- WebmasterSolutions (webmastersolutions.com), a provider

of performance testing and monitoring services for e-business, recently

announced the general availability of AppMonitor 2.1, the second generation

of the company's flagship application monitoring service.

New features include an upgraded control panel, user definable maintenance windows, full-page

downloads of all images and objects of each page, and rich HTML/Flash

consolidated reporting. AppMonitor 2.1 also offers users the ability to

export performance data to enterprise reporting applications using XML.

AppMonitor 2.1 is a consultative, outsourced service that provides

end-to-end transaction monitoring of Web applications from outside the

firewall. Based on the defined user transactions, such as order fulfillment,

stock purchase and catalog procurement, WebmasterSolutions creates test

scripts to continuously challenge the performance and availability of

e-business functions. These test scripts can be executed as often as every

five minutes from one of WebmasterSolutions 15 globally distributed

monitoring agents. If potential performance problems or errors are detected,

instant alerts are executed, via pager or phone, and performance reports are

delivered daily via email.

"AppMonitor is used to provide 24/7 functionality testing and performance

monitoring of all components of an e-commerce site, including Web servers,

network connectivity, applications, and databases," said Tim Drees, Chief

Project Architect, WebmasterSolutions. "Understanding that the performance

and availability of web applications directly affects the success of

specific business functions, such as sales, marketing and e-commerce

initiatives, our new XML Data Access API provides customers with the ability

to access and integrate data generated by AppMonitor into their corporate

reporting processes."
